服务器部署ChatGPT: 详细教程与FAQ

什么是ChatGPT?

ChatGPT是一种基于大规模预训练模型的对话生成工具,可以用于构建自动对话系统、聊天机器人等应用。

为什么在服务器上部署ChatGPT?

服务器部署ChatGPT可以实现更大规模的对话生成,提高性能并支持更多用户同时访问。

如何在服务器上部署ChatGPT

步骤一: 准备服务器环境

  • 选择合适的云服务器,确保具有足够的计算资源和存储空间
  • 安装操作系统和相关依赖,如Python环境、CUDA等

步骤二: 下载并配置ChatGPT代码

  • 从GitHub上下载最新的ChatGPT代码
  • 根据文档指引,配置环境变量、安装依赖库等

步骤三: 下载预训练模型

  • 下载适合服务器部署的预训练模型,如GPT-3、GPT-2等
  • 将模型文件放置到合适的路径,并配置代码中的模型路径

步骤四: 启动服务

  • 使用命令行启动ChatGPT服务,并指定端口号等参数
  • 测试服务是否正常运行,可以通过发送请求进行简单对话测试

常见问题解答

如何选择合适的云服务器?

  • 需要根据预期的并发访问量、计算需求等因素进行选择
  • 建议选择具有GPU加速功能的云服务器,以提升对话生成性能

如何优化ChatGPT在服务器上的性能?

  • 可以通过调整批处理大小、优化模型推理代码等方式来提升性能
  • 合理配置服务器资源,如GPU显存、CPU核心数等

如何保障服务器部署的ChatGPT安全性?

  • 可以通过配置防火墙、访问控制策略等手段来加强服务器安全性
  • 定期更新ChatGPT代码和模型,及时修补安全漏洞

如何实现多用户同时访问ChatGPT?

  • 可以通过负载均衡、多实例部署等方式来支持多用户访问
  • 合理设计对话生成服务接口,避免单一用户占用过多资源

结论

通过本文的教程,读者可以轻松了解如何在服务器上部署ChatGPT,并解决常见问题。

正文完